summaryrefslogtreecommitdiffstats
path: root/cpukit/libmd
diff options
context:
space:
mode:
authorSebastian Huber <sebastian.huber@embedded-brains.de>2010-09-13 13:57:32 +0000
committerSebastian Huber <sebastian.huber@embedded-brains.de>2010-09-13 13:57:32 +0000
commit1e4d7b8835de62120a41a7ad085267aa3149ce8e (patch)
tree81696c46a6da54c804d8449d1f4a628d555a5eec /cpukit/libmd
parent2010-09-08 Sebastian Huber <sebastian.huber@embedded-brains.de> (diff)
downloadrtems-1e4d7b8835de62120a41a7ad085267aa3149ce8e.tar.bz2
2010-09-13 Sebastian Huber <sebastian.huber@embedded-brains.de>
* libmd/md5.h: C++ compatibility.
Diffstat (limited to 'cpukit/libmd')
-rw-r--r--cpukit/libmd/md5.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/cpukit/libmd/md5.h b/cpukit/libmd/md5.h
index 1756a31228..543c539bc1 100644
--- a/cpukit/libmd/md5.h
+++ b/cpukit/libmd/md5.h
@@ -41,6 +41,10 @@
#include <stdint.h>
+#ifdef __cplusplus
+extern "C" {
+#endif /* __cplusplus */
+
/* typedef a 32-bit type */
typedef uint32_t UINT4;
@@ -56,5 +60,9 @@ void MD5Init (MD5_CTX *);
void MD5Update (MD5_CTX *, const unsigned char *, unsigned int);
void MD5Final (unsigned char [16], MD5_CTX *);
+#ifdef __cplusplus
+}
+#endif /* __cplusplus */
+
#define __MD5_INCLUDE__
#endif /* __MD5_INCLUDE__ */